Some of the energy saved and resold will come from traditional energy efficiency (EE) investments, which companies have been making for many years. However, the explosion of smart digital- and internet-connected devices has created a new form of energy efficiency that adds immediate control over equipment as a new EE strategy.

In the case of stock options, the EFV formula is typically a Black-Scholes-Merton option-pricing model that, rooted in the “efficient markets hypothesis,” assumes that changes in a company’s stock-price exhibit a log-normal distribution and thus predicts that most stock-price changes will be very small.
